Rock Rivals car crash TV fails to rock its rivalsRock Rivals failed to rock its rivals when it launched on ITV1 last night. Just 3.9 million tuned in. Rock Rivals is a drama based on an X Factor style reality show. Sean Gallagher plays Mal, a Simon Cowell style judge on the show. The paunch doesn't add to his credibility nor does his his prediliction for a girlfriend who has also eaten a few too many pies. The girlfriend switches on Mal's radio mic before a session of rumpy pumpy in the dressing room after the show. The audio is fed into the green room where Mal's wife, the Sharon Osbourne of the series, hears the grunts along as do the contestants and crew. Karina, played by the inevitable ex-soap actress Michelle Collins, then shows her displeasure by driving a perfectly good Ferrari into the pool and asking for a divorce. The judge styled on Louis Walsh looks like he will be a bit-part player in this drama just like he is on the real thing. And it looks like only two of the contestants will play much of a role in the series. Luke is the confident young guy who has a gay stalker in competition with his contestant girlfriend for his affections. Bethany is the despairing female contestant who tried to injure or kill herself twice in the first episode. Mal supports Luke and Karina supports Bethany. Both of them will no doubt get to the show's final in week six and the lucky viewers will be able to decide which of them wins. Two endings have already been recorded. |
